Married at First Sight, sometimes better known as MAFS, has turned the world of reality TV on its head. The show features a series of couples who have been matched up by a team of relationship experts. As they prepare to marry a stranger, the couples must learn to overcome their honeymoon phase to see if they are actually compatible.
While some of the couples are perfectly suited and go on to live happily ever after, there are a handful of them that crash and burn. As such, fans quickly fell in love with this series because, although it has quite a sweet premise, the show is teeming with drama. Therefore, some of the show’s memorable couples are the ones who aren’t exactly made for each other.

This Couple Tried but Just Couldn’t Make Things Work
First appearing in Season 13, Jose and Rachel managed to repair their marriage and actually started a proper relationship after the show. While this may seem adorable, fans of MAFS will know that they were never really meant to be. On the one hand, Jose was a perfectionist and worried about Rachel’s improper habits. In contrast, Rachel dropped a bombshell when she accidentally called her new husband by her ex’s name, which caused a lot of tension.
The pair split shortly after the reunion and believed that going their separate ways would be the best decision for their futures. Since leaving the show, Jose has been hard at work as a NASA Mission Flight Specialist and Rachel has been busy traveling to an abundance of exotic locations. Yet, since the pair no longer follow each other on Instagram, it’s assumed that they have cut contact.

This Pair Enjoyed a Successful Swap
When Jacqui first joined MAFS she was paired with Ryan, a project manager from NSW. While their bond was nothing to write home about, fans were shocked when Jacqui announced that she had started dating fellow contestant Clint. It seemed that her co-star slid into her DMs during filming and the pair seemed to hit it off.
While Ryan was obviously pretty upset, certain fans will be pleased to hear that Clint and Jacqui are still going strong. She also seems to enjoy teasing the producers by posting photos of herself inside her new man’s house and highlighting the show’s behind-the-scenes secrets. As such, Clint and Jacqui’s relationship proves that the experiment does work, just not in the way that fans would expect.

This Couple Was Kicked Off of the Show Entirely
After countless episodes and numerous spin-offs, audiences would assume that nothing could phase these experts. However, David and Haley floored audiences with their toxic spats and unusual dynamics. After Haley shared a kiss with fellow contestant Michael, David retaliated by dunking his wife’s toothbrush into the toilet. So, after an expletive-filled rant during the commitment ceremony, expert John Aiken forced them to leave the experiment.
The marriages on MAFS are not legally binding and are seen more as a social experiment.
It comes as no surprise that the couple are no longer together and do not remain in contact. David has even gone on to say that he regrets taking part in the show. Even though they made history by being the first couple to be booted off of the show, it appears that they have since left the world of reality TV behind them.
